The Future of Industrial and Logistics Real Estate in Bangalore

Electronic City is a satisfactory example of the transformation of the city’s development into India’s technological capital. Formally a township developed to accommodate IT parks, this extended region has been in the process of changing rapidly in the recent past and now stands as not only a key technology centre but also as an influential player in industrial, logistics and warehousing segments. While Bangalore is growing bigger, Electronic City, owing to its favourable location and infrastructural improvements, assumes the role of an industrial and logistics hub, which entails the demand for warehouses and defining the new look of the city’s real estate. This blog explores why Electronic City is poised to be the future of industrial and logistics real estate, with a focus on the demand for warehouses for rent in Bangalore and the role of real estate consultants in navigating this booming market.

Rise of Industrial Infrastructure

Electronic City has realized its status as an IT hub and that has been precisely why Electronic City shot into popularity very early in this new economy. In the long run, the area has received much investment in general and particular attention has been devoted to connection, roads, utilities, and various commercial fields apart from the technology companies. Now, it accommodates manufacturing industries, industrial parks, and logistic facilities coupled with the availability of a sound transport system to transport materials within and outside Bangalore. This expansion has boosted the demand for warehouses and industrial commercial spaces keeping Electronic City as a center for real estate developers and investors.

Real Estate Investment Opportunities.

The location is beneficial for real estate consultants and investors since Electronic City is a hub of opportunities. These potential investments extend the area’s attractions beyond typical core business and residential zones since the area is already developed as an IT and industrial zone. There is now more concentration in producing combined industrial zones and logistics parks with new additional facilities that meet the needs of the industry. These improvements not only increase the functionality of the organizations but also appeal to tenants seeking strategically located, suitable warehouse space in Bangalore’s upcoming industrial zone.

Infrastructure and Connectivity Advantages

Infrastructure-wise, Electronic City has one of its major strengths in its strategically developed physical infrastructure and transport network. The neighbourhood is served by an extensive network of roadways, including the elevated highway to the city centre and other stations. Besides, proposed and ongoing metro rail projects and road expansions are expected to improve accessibility and avoid logistic challenges. Such infrastructure developments not only ensure faster transport of commodities but also help in cutting down the overhead expenses of organizations that are interested in warehousing or industrial space in Electronic City.

Future Prospects and Growth Trajectory

As per the future perspective, Electronic City has great potential to grow or expand more, especially in industrial and logistics real estate. The investment policies incorporated by the Karnataka government for encouraging industrial growth and development and infrastructure upgradation make it more attractive to investors and traders. With Bangalore solidifying its status as one of Asia’s major business and technology centres, Electronic City’s importance as an industrial hub for the creation of employment and as a centre of gravity for the city’s logistics industry is expected to grow further and thereby ensure a continued healthy market for the take-up of warehousing spaces into the future.

Technological Integration and Innovation

Keeping aside the physical aspect, the industrial and logistics aspects of Electronic City are among the most advanced in adopting new technologies for its functioning. Today, IoT (Internet of Things) devices, AI (Artificial Intelligence), and automation devices are changing the face of Warehouse management and logistics. Businesses are also using data analytics to improve spare chain management, cost of inventories, and delivery time. Not only does this improve operation flexibility but also sets up Electronic City as a go-to destination for technological solutions in industrial real estate.

Strategic Partnerships and Collaborations.

Industry partnerships between bureaucratic structures – ministries and local governments on one side and different companies and academic establishments on the other side are vital for the formation of Electronic City industrial profile. Cross collaborations between the public and private sectors connect infrastructure development, policy, and skill-enhancement measures that help businesses in the region to grow. Also, the partnerships developed with research institutions brought benefits to the formation of innovation clusters and technology incubators that promote business development and industrialization. These business enterprises enhance the status of Electronic City as a progressive industrial city ready to exploit new opportunities in changing Bangalore’s real estate.

Conclusion

In conclusion, Electronic City symbolizes not only Information Technology as the industry but also demonstrates how Bangalore has successfully transformed into a diversified economic city. These factors put and place this vibrant locality firmly in the industrial, logistical, and technological backbone needs of Bangalore’s real estate market. It explains why stakeholders such as real estate consultants, developers, and investors can easily consider the prospect of profiting from the exponentially growing need for warehouses and industrial plants in Electronic City. With such a development in the city infrastructure, Electronic City is set to be the city’s game changer in industrial and logistics real estate as one of the significant growth prospects for the future growth of the city of Bangalore.
